MTA issues RFP for RNG
The Metropolitan Transportation Authority (MTA) today issued a request for proposals to purchase ultra-low-carbon renewable natural gas (RNG) to fuel its fleet of about 800 New York City buses currently running on compressed natural gas (CNG). This represents the first step any heavy-duty vehicle fleet in New York City has taken towards adopting RNG.

Chevron adds EV in CA
Chevron is adding EV fast charging to select company owned and operated gas stations in California. To date, more than a dozen fast chargers – ranging from 50 kW to 100 kW capacity – are already operational or under construction at five Chevron stations in Los Angeles and the San Francisco Bay area.

Honda explores 2nd life for batteries
Honda announced it is conducting research in partnership with American Electric Power (AEP), the Ohio-based electric utility, to develop a network of used electric vehicle (EV) batteries that could be integrated into AEP's electricity system. Honda will provide used Fit EV batteries to AEP, which will study integrating the batteries into the utility’s electricity grid.
